Output db54772d6d7d63653d7f1d50a809639ddf9a0bd5a4b3236df19493fad38d757f:1

value
28318669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c31f05e1de6557e1cdd56d6efbc53eac81aff1e OP_EQUAL
address
3QgW2hjaq2YfquEyodsBzCMj1AZz3s3qWA
transaction
db54772d6d7d63653d7f1d50a809639ddf9a0bd5a4b3236df19493fad38d757f
spent
true